Hi All,
I am going down tomarrow morning about 10 to pay off my Raptor. I called the dealership last week without giving my name to try and get another story about delivery times. I got the same blah blah blah about the delivery, but when I told the salesman that I live 40 miles away, which I do, he started saying that I should come down and they would "work something out with the doc and setup fees" I had already paid these when I went down in july. They came to 413.35 all total and were not flexable then. I got off the phone and it started to bug me that I had to pay these but someone else might not have to.
So today I called down there as myself and told my salesman that I had sold my Scrambler and that I would be down tomarrow to pay it off, but that I had a problem. I told him that I had a friend in another state that worked at a Yamaha dealer that was not charging any fees, and that I didn't want to be a jerk but that 400+ dollars was a lot of money. ( Keep in mind that I had planned all along to buy the 540 dollar 3 year ext warranty)
He said that he understood and he would call me back. He called back an hour later and told me that he had talked it over with his "BOSS" and that the best they could do was wave the fees if I would be willing to buy the 3 yr warranty for 495.00 (thats 55 dollars less than they quoted me in july!). The moral of the story is that by just asking I managed to save 600 dollars!!!
the new OTD price is 6994.99
He also said that, although I am #4 on the list of 4, the #1 and #2 guys are holding out for B/W Raptors, and that #3 and myself will take either, so if the first 2 are blue I will be the second one to get one!!!
See Ya Drew
